Experience Details
Wildlife Encounters:
We'll have chances to spot hippos, chimpanzees, baboons, and a vast array of bird species
Ecosystem Diversity:
We'll navigate through various habitats including mangroves, tropical woodlands, and savannas
Cultural Immersion:
We'll visit remote villages, interacting with friendly locals and learning about their way of life
Historical Exploration:
We’ll discover sites dating from prehistoric times to the colonial period
River Navigation:
We’ll experience the challenges and joys of river sailing, including passing under the Senegambia Bridge at low tide
